To pytanie pojawia się częściej niż jakiekolwiek inne.
Lata pracy włożone w budowanie ruchu organicznego. Pozycje dla słów kluczowych, które przynoszą realne zapytania. Perspektywa ich utraty, nawet tymczasowej, budzi uzasadniony niepokój.
To zrozumiałe. Uczciwa odpowiedź brzmi tak: zła migracja zniszczy pozycje. Dobra je poprawi.
Różnica leży w procesie, nie w szczęściu.
Rzeczywiste ryzyko: proces, nie platforma
Oto co faktycznie niszczy pozycje podczas migracji:
- Uszkodzone adresy URL bez przekierowań. Jeśli /services/web-design staje się /our-services/website-design-services bez przekierowania 301, Google widzi martwą stronę i nową bez historii. Cały kapitał wypracowany przez stary adres URL przepada.
- Brakujące lub zmienione metadane. Gdy starannie zoptymalizowane tagi tytułów i opisy meta zostaną usunięte podczas przebudowy, Google ocenia każdą stronę od nowa.
- Utracone treści. Jeśli strony są łączone, usuwane lub znacząco przepisywane bez przekierowań, powiązane z nimi pozycje znikają.
- Uszkodzone linki wewnętrzne. Zmiana struktury linkowania wewnętrznego bez aktualizacji odnośników zatrzymuje przepływ kapitału linkowego w serwisie.
- Wolne ponowne indeksowanie. Brak przesłania nowej mapy witryny i brak monitorowania Google Search Console po uruchomieniu może sprawić, że Google potrzebuje tygodni, by odnaleźć i zindeksować nowe strony.
Żaden z tych problemów nie wynika z platformy. Wszystkie są problemami procesu migracji. I wszystkim można zapobiec.
Lista kontrolna przekierowań 301
To najważniejszy element każdej migracji serwisu. Każdy stary adres URL musi mieć przypisany nowy odpowiednik. Bez wyjątków.
Dokładny proces wygląda następująco:
- Skanowanie istniejącego serwisu. Przy użyciu Screaming Frog lub własnego crawlera wyodrębnia się każdy adres URL: strony, wpisy, obrazy, pliki PDF. Typowy serwis: 20-200 adresów URL. Większe serwisy: 500 i więcej.
- Mapowanie starych adresów URL na nowe. Każda strona otrzymuje miejsce docelowe. Jeśli strona jest usuwana, przekierowanie trafia do najbliższej tematycznie alternatywy.
- Wdrożenie przekierowań 301. Nie 302 (tymczasowych). Trwałe przekierowania 301 informują Google: "Ta treść przeniosła się tutaj. Przenieś wszystkie sygnały rankingowe."
- Testowanie każdego przekierowania. Przed uruchomieniem pełna lista adresów URL jest weryfikowana narzędziem do sprawdzania przekierowań. Każde musi działać poprawnie.
- Monitoring po uruchomieniu. Przez pierwsze dwa tygodnie błędy 404 w Google Search Console są sprawdzane codziennie. Każdy adres, którego Google nie może znaleźć, natychmiast otrzymuje przekierowanie.
Migracja metatagów i danych strukturalnych
Tagi tytułów, opisy meta, tagi Open Graph i dane strukturalne (schema markup) to miesiące lub lata pracy nad SEO. Utrata ich podczas migracji przypomina wyrzucenie systemu segregatorów podczas przeprowadzki biura.
Proces:
- Wyodrębnienie wszystkich istniejących metadanych zanim cokolwiek zostanie zmienione. Tagi tytułów, opisy, kanoniczne adresy URL, tagi Open Graph, dane strukturalne, wszystko udokumentowane.
- Migracja do systemu meta nowej platformy. W Next.js oznacza to Metadata API, natywny, typowany sposób definiowania metatagów na poziomie strony. Bez wtyczek. Bez Yoast. Tylko czyste, niezawodne metadane.
- Weryfikacja po uruchomieniu przy użyciu Google Rich Results Test i Search Console. Każda strona sprawdzona.
Core Web Vitals: gdzie migracja poprawia pozycje
Oto co większość osób pomija: dobrze przeprowadzona migracja nie tylko zachowuje pozycje, lecz je wzmacnia.
Google uwzględnia Core Web Vitals jako sygnał rankingowy od 2021 roku. Trzy istotne metryki to:
- Largest Contentful Paint (LCP): szybkość wyświetlenia głównej treści
- Cumulative Layout Shift (CLS): stopień przesunięcia elementów układu
- Interaction to Next Paint (INP): szybkość reakcji serwisu na kliknięcia
Wiele serwisów opartych na WordPress ma trudności z tymi metrykami na urządzeniach mobilnych bez dedykowanej optymalizacji. Serwisy zbudowane w Next.js zazwyczaj spełniają progi z dużym zapasem.
| Core Web Vital | WordPress (bez optymalizacji) | Next.js (typowo) | Próg Google |
|---|---|---|---|
| LCP | 3,5-6,0 s | 0,6-1,2 s | < 2,5 s |
| CLS | 0,15-0,35 | 0,01-0,05 | < 0,1 |
| INP | 200-500 ms | 50-100 ms | < 200 ms |
Dane rzeczywiste: zmiany pozycji po migracji
Pozycje każdego klienta po migracji są monitorowane przez co najmniej 90 dni. Oto co pojawia się regularnie:
Tygodnie 1-2 po uruchomieniu: Drobne wahania. Google ponownie indeksuje serwis. To normalny i spodziewany etap. Pozycje mogą tymczasowo spaść o 1-3 miejsca.
Tygodnie 3-4: Pozycje się stabilizują. Większość słów kluczowych wraca na pierwotne miejsce lub je poprawia. Strony, które wcześniej nie spełniały Core Web Vitals, często skaczą o 2-5 pozycji.
Miesiące 2-3: Wynik netto jest pozytywny. W przypadku tych migracji przeciętny klient odnotowuje wzrost organicznych wyświetleń o 12-18% w ciągu 90 dni.
Lista kontrolna SEO przy migracji (podsumowanie)
- Pełne skanowanie adresów URL i mapowanie ukończone
- Przekierowania 301 skonfigurowane dla każdego starego adresu URL
- Wszystkie przekierowania przetestowane i zweryfikowane
- Tytuły meta i opisy zmigrowane
- Dane strukturalne (schema markup) zmigrowane lub ulepszone
- Mapa witryny XML wygenerowana i przesłana do Google Search Console
- Właściwość Google Search Console zweryfikowana dla nowego serwisu
- Linki wewnętrzne zaktualizowane do nowych adresów URL (bez łańcuchów przekierowań)
- Kanoniczne adresy URL ustawione poprawnie na wszystkich stronach
- Plik robots.txt sprawdzony pod kątem niezamierzonego noindex/nofollow
- Monitoring błędów 404 aktywny po uruchomieniu
- Core Web Vitals zweryfikowane i spełniające progi na wszystkich kluczowych stronach
Podsumowanie
Prawidłowo przeprowadzona migracja nie pozbawi serwisu pozycji SEO. Najprawdopodobniej je poprawi.
Ryzyko tworzy zły proces przebudowy: pominięte przekierowania, utracone metadane, uszkodzone adresy URL. To problem procesu, nie platformy.
Chcą Państwo sprawdzić aktualną kondycję SEO swojego serwisu?
Bezpłatny raport zdrowia WordPress dostępny jest pod adresem webvise.io/wp-health-report. Raport zawiera wyniki PageSpeed, ostrzeżenia bezpieczeństwa oraz prognozowaną wydajność po migracji do Next.js.
Dla osób gotowych omówić szczegóły: bezpłatna 20-minutowa rozmowa do zarezerwowania na webvise.io